Cost of Footer Digging in Longmont

When planning a construction or landscaping project in Longmont, CO, one crucial aspect to consider is the cost of footer digging. Footers are essential for the stability and longevity of any structure, whether it's a new home, an addition, or a commercial building. Understanding the factors that affect the cost and the common tasks involved can help you budget effectively for your project.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Soil Type: The type of soil in Longmont can vary, impacting the difficulty and cost of excavation.
  • Depth and Width of Footers: Deeper and wider footers require more labor and materials, increasing costs.
  • Accessibility of Site: Sites that are difficult to access may require special equipment or additional labor.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
  • Weather Conditions: Adverse weather can slow down the project, leading to increased labor costs.
  • Labor Rates: The cost of labor in Longmont can fluctuate, impacting the overall expense of footer digging.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(USD)
Basic Footer Digging (per linear foot) $10 - $20
Soil Testing and Analysis $200 - $500
Permit Fees $50 - $200
Concrete Pouring (per cubic yard) $100 - $150
Site Preparation and Clearing $500 - $1,000
Labor (per hour) $50 - $100
